President at La Senza International Corporation

April 1998 - August 2010

Started and led the expansion of La Senza beyond its Canadian borders into 45 countries and over 500 standalone stores. Set up all aspects of the operation, negotiated all Franchise and License deals, managed and led the business from inception through growth and maturity, including the sale of the La Senza business to Limited Brands in 2007 for $720 million. La Senza is a leading global retailer of intimate apparel, part of Limited Brands, owners of Victoria's Secret, Bath & Body Works, Henri Bendel and other brands.

Vice-President, Ecommerce at La Senza

April 2000 - January 2007

Started lasenza.com and grew it into Canada's leading online lingerie retailer. Led the development of multiple iterations of a leading-edge eCommerce website for the global lingerie brand. Oversaw all aspects of the business from software platform to order fulfillment and customer service call centre.

Managing Director at La Senza plc

September 1994 - April 1998

Led the green field startup of La Senza in the United Kingdom with the opening of the first store there in 1994. Led the company through an IPO in 1996. Opened the first 50 stores as Managing Director until the sale of the business in 1998. Today it is the largest lingerie retailer in the UK with over 250 stores.

Co-Founder and Partner at Boutique iStore Canada Inc.

October 2007

iStore is a digital lifestyle brand, selling products and accessories for entertainment, information, productivity and fashion and established around the Apple ecosystems surrounding iPad, iPhone, iPod and Mac There are 8 standalone "Boutique iStore" locations in airports across Canada (Montreal (2), Toronto, Vancouver (2), Edmonton (2) and Calgary) with plans for further immediate expansion in Canada and internationally. The first U.S. iStore opened in Boston Logan Airport in April 2012, and at least 4 additional U.S. stores are planned in 2012. In addition, the first "iStore Express" automated retail machine went live in Jan 2012 at Calgary Airport (YYC), with 20 installations planned across Canada over the next 12 months.
